Assistant Professor of Public Administration

Job Description:

Our Online NASPAA-accredited Master of Public Administration (MPA) program provides an engaged learning environment emphasizing both practical and theoretical concepts of public administration. SUU is a leader in experiential learning, and the MPA program encourages high-impact learning practices throughout the curriculum to bridge theory and practice.

Southern Utah University invites applications for the position of Assistant Professor of Public Administration. This is a full-time, 9-month, tenure-track position to begin August 16, 2024. The first consideration of applications will begin May 1, 2024. The position will remain open until filled.

Duties and Responsibilities:

SUU is primarily a teaching university and the successful hire is expected to teach 12 credit hours each semester. We are seeking an engaging Assistant Professor who can teach a variety of online courses in our Master of Public Administration program. While the ability to teach general courses in public administration is essential, we are also looking for a candidate who is interested in working with community partners and providing our students with opportunities for experiential learning. Most of our students are in-service professionals, therefore a candidate with formal job experience as a practitioner in the government or nonprofit sector is preferred. MPA courses are offered online, so the candidate will be expected to teach high quality courses in the online environment. Candidates may also have the opportunity to teach undergraduate Political Science courses as needed. Teaching experience at the university level is valued, especially experience teaching online.

In addition to teaching, our MPA Program emphasizes community engagement, so that our students actively work with community partners in the Intermountain West and beyond. The ideal candidate would be passionate about developing projects and relationships with local and state governments that impact both our students and our communities. Remote teaching candidates who can still meet these objectives will be considered.

Southern Utah University's Carnegie Classification is registered as a "Master's Colleges and Universities: Larger Programs (M1)." Accordingly, under SUU Policy 2.0, the successful hire will be expected to keep current in the field by attending and presenting in professional forums and contributing to the scholarly discourse regularly.
